Output 85a86ff6eadb975da3c4cf22dde6a0b85f42dca96cc01da95a3a7210fdc0e4a2:2

value
199866230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a5f504730d44cfe90cb94f34673b9aed49a3ecb OP_EQUAL
address
39vrvK5jDN58DA5wzQ21mRSXUGhZYQHPdT
transaction
85a86ff6eadb975da3c4cf22dde6a0b85f42dca96cc01da95a3a7210fdc0e4a2
confirmations
346194
spent
true